summaryrefslogtreecommitdiff
path: root/ceph-bin/PKGB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'ceph-bin/PKGBUILD')
-rw-r--r--ceph-bin/PKGBUILD24
1 files changed, 20 insertions, 4 deletions
diff --git a/ceph-bin/PKGBUILD b/ceph-bin/PKGBUILD
index 16eff26e2..706f8ec01 100644
--- a/ceph-bin/PKGBUILD
+++ b/ceph-bin/PKGBUILD
@@ -35,10 +35,26 @@ package_ceph-libs-bin() {
}
package_ceph-bin() {
- depends=("ceph-libs=${pkgver}-${pkgrel}"
- 'boost-libs' 'curl' 'fuse2' 'fuse3' 'fmt' 'glibc' 'gperftools' 'java-runtime'
- 'keyutils' 'leveldb' 'libaio' 'libutil-linux' 'librdkafka' 'cryptsetup' 'libnl'
- 'ncurses'
+ _pinned_dependencies=(
+ 'gcc-libs=12.2.0'
+ 'glibc>=2.36'
+ 'libblkid.so=1'
+ 'libcap-ng.so=0'
+ 'libcryptsetup.so=12'
+ 'libcurl.so=4'
+ 'libexpat.so=1'
+ 'libicuuc.so=71'
+ 'libkeyutils.so=1'
+ 'libncursesw.so=6'
+ 'libnl=3.7.0'
+ 'libudev.so=1'
+ 'lz4=1:1.9.4'
+ 'openssl=1.1.1.q'
+ 'zlib=1:1.2.13'
+ )
+ depends=("ceph-libs=${pkgver}-${pkgrel}" "${_pinned_dependencies[@]}"
+ 'boost-libs' 'fuse2' 'fuse3' 'fmt' 'glibc' 'gperftools' 'java-runtime'
+ 'keyutils' 'leveldb' 'libaio' 'libutil-linux' 'librdkafka'
'nss' 'oath-toolkit' 'python'
'snappy' 'sudo' 'systemd-libs' 'lua' 'gawk'
'xfsprogs')